Khaosan Road
The perfect street for travellers on a budget who want to buy cheap clothes, cheap souvenirs and then party into the early hours.

Lumphini Park
This green breathing space provides a quiet haven for rest, sport and recreation away from the madding crowds, for residents and visitors alike.
